The Fisker Newport has 16 cu ft of cargo space. In practice that is 2 checked suitcases, or 8 carry-ons, or about 12 supermarket bags. A folded pushchair fits.
What actually fits in a Newport
Cubic feet are an abstraction — 16 cu ft means nothing until you load it. Here is the same number in things people actually load, 2 checked cases or 8 carry-ons for the Fisker Newport, with a packing allowance — a boot is not a cube, and corners go to waste.
| What you are loading | How many fit | Each item |
|---|---|---|
| Checked suitcases | 2 | 27 × 21 × 14″ — 4.6 cu ft |
| Carry-on cases | 8 | 22 × 14 × 9″ — 1.6 cu ft |
| Supermarket bags | 12 | about 1 cu ft each |
| Golf bags | 2 | full set, about 5 cu ft |
| Folded pushchair | Fits | about 6 cu ft |
Counts assume 80% usable volume: luggage does not tessellate, and a wheel arch eats the rest.

How we count
Cargo and passenger volumes come from EPA interior-volume records — the same figures manufacturers file for the window sticker, measured to a standard method rather than claimed in a brochure.
The luggage counts are ours — 2 checked cases for the Fisker Newport come out of its 16 cu ft. We assume 80% usable volume, because a boot is not a cube: wheel arches, a sloping tailgate and the shape of the cases themselves waste the rest, which is why the Fisker Newport counts as 12.8 cu ft of usable space rather than 16. Suitcase sizes are the airline standards — 22 × 14 × 9″ for carry-on, 27 × 21 × 14″ for checked, so the Fisker Newport takes 8 of the small ones. Numbers are deliberately conservative; if we say four cases fit, four cases fit.
